News & Reviews

  • Wilco Reveals New Details of Summer's Solid Sound Festival Lineup

    Tune in to The Late Late Show with Craig Ferguson tonight on CBS to see Wilco perform "Deeper Down" off Wilco (the album). The band has just announced a diverse array of musical guests for the line up of its first Solid Sound Festival, a three-day event to be held at MASS MoCA, August 13–15, in North Adams, Massachusetts. In addition to performances by the band and its members, the festival will feature Avi Buffalo, Vetiver, Sir Richard Bishop, Mountain Man, Brenda, The Books, Deep Blue Organ Trio, and legendary puppet theater company Bread and Puppet.

  • Wilco Launches Tour of Japan, New Zealand, and Australia After "Slam-Bang Finish" to US Tour (Post-Gazette)

    Wilco begins a two-week tour of Japan, New Zealand, and Australia with a set at the Big Cat in Osaka tonight. All five shows in Australia feature an opening set from Liam Finn. The latest tour begins less than two weeks after what the Pittsburgh Post-Gazette called the "slam-bang finish" of the band's fully sold-out US tour in Pittsburgh.

About this Album

"It's the best it's ever felt," said Jeff Tweedy of these Wilco performances recorded at Chicago's Vic Theatre May 4-7, 2005. Rolling Stone calls Kicking Television “a love letter to Wilco's dedicated fans and a definitive live statement from America's foremost rock impressionists.”

This Kicking Television LP box set includes an audiophile, 180-gram vinyl pressing of the album on four discs, featuring eight previously unreleased bonus tracks, and a fold-out commemorative poster modeled after the Chicago skyline.

Credits

MUSICIANS
Wilco:
Jeff Tweedy, guitar, vocals
John Stirratt, bass, vocals
Glenn Kotche, drums, percussion
Michael Jorgensen, keyboards, piano
Nels Cline, guitars, lap steel
Pat Sansone, keyboards, guitars, vocals

Additional Musicians:
Nick Broste, slide trombone
Patrick Newbery, trumpet, flugelhorn
Rich Parenti, baritone saxophone

PRODUCTION CREDITS
Produced by Wilco
Recorded live May 4-7, 2005, at the Vic Theatre, Chicago, IL
Recorded by Mike Konopka and Timothy Powell for Metro Mobile, Glenview, IL
Assisted by Dan Glomski, Michael Ways and Jordan McCormick
Mixed by Jim Scott with Stan Doty at Sunset Sound, Los Angeles, CA
Mastered for CD by Nick Webb at Abbey Road, London, UK
Re-mastered for vinyl by Robert C. Ludwig at Gateway Mastering, Portland, ME
Technical Crew: Jason Tobias, Frankie Montuoro, Matt Zivich, Chris Hoffman, Nathan Baker, Deborah Johnson and Andy Nemcik
Live mix by Stan Doty
Shows produced by Jam Productions, Chicago, IL

Original CD design by Doyle Partners
Vinyl package design by Lawrence Azerrad
